A 63-year-old man charged with murdering a woman whose body was found near a lagoon was ordered held in County Jail in lieu of $2 million bail.

Elmer Lee Nance of Barstow pleaded innocent to killing Nancy White, 22, whose car broke down Aug. 27, 1986, on Interstate 8, 2 miles east of Lake Jennings Park Road. Her nude body was found five days later near Batiquitos Lagoon in Carlsbad.

White’s death is one of 45 being investigated by the Metropolitan Homicide Task Force, which was formed in 1988 to investigate the deaths of 44 women and one man in the past six years.

Most of the bodies have been dumped in either East or North County.

Nance is also charged with raping White and of rape with a foreign object. White died of strangulation.

Deputy Dist. Atty. Richard Lewis said Nance is not suspected of any other homicides. Nance was arrested Friday at a bakery in Barstow.

San Diego Municipal Judge Joan Weber on Tuesday scheduled a Nov. 18 preliminary hearing.

The victim lived in Orange County and was returning from Yuma, Ariz., where she had visited her husband, who was temporarily stationed there in the military.
